- What should the customer know about your pricing (e.g., discounts, fees)?
My goal is to bring a luxe look to more people for less money. I focus on using and re-using materials to reduce costs and then pass that on to the customer. If you're looking to rent decor items that are already created (not custom), I ask for a 25% deposit to hold the item/date. Custom orders require, at least, a 50% deposit when booking.
